Away is a 2016 British drama film directed by David Blair and starring Timothy Spall and Juno Temple.[1]
The film premiered at the 2016 Edinburgh International Film Festival.[2] It was released in the United Kingdom digitally on 8 May 2017 by 101 Films and on DVD on 15 May 2017 by Metrodome.[3][4]
In Blackpool, an unlikely friendship blossoms between a lonely, suicidal widower and a young woman trying to escape an abusive ex-boyfriend.
